Interior decorator, painting vs interior designer

The differences between interior decorators, painting and interior designers can be seen in a few details. Each job has different responsibilities and duties. While it typically takes More than 10 years to become an interior decorator, painting, becoming an interior designer takes usually requires 2-4 years. Additionally, an interior designer has an average salary of $52,482, which is higher than the $46,033 average annual salary of an interior decorator, painting.

The top three skills for an interior decorator, painting include faux finishes, exterior painting and caulking. The most important skills for an interior designer are revit, space planning, and sketch.
